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98731185 2111505829 32212 251973 395803
72 08460
72 08460
591639 83 38321 4048
All about undefined
Interested in learning more?
72 08460
591639 83 38321 4048
See more
9760 22707 612
03319 1655 29004649 787 0087555538
See more
544296 790
84501226300 79610 6489447 31
See more